>>   Hello all
>> After installing the latest version of the country file, and merging
>> with my old one, I find that for example a QSO with PJ2MI in 1992 is
>> still counted for the "new" entity of Curacao, and a QSO with PJ0J in
>> 1987 is still counted for the "new" entity of St Maarten.
>> It looks like the callsign mapping does not consider the start date of
>> the (potential) new entities when callsigns are imported.
>> Is this a bug, or have I done something wrong ?
>> Thanks + 73
>> Paul F6EXV
> Merging new CTY into old CTY does not work.
>
> Merging old CTY into new CTY does work, but it means more file moving/copying.
